Output 7e7508fcdc99e95ca5047183663ea933530f834d2e8a7dcfa0af16ba896159b4:8

value
762316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e09d97fffef4a641badf3e4a280bd7e546f4729 OP_EQUAL
address
3QrFMdak9AE1iGQqNpP4MzdScHEQGumDrj
transaction
7e7508fcdc99e95ca5047183663ea933530f834d2e8a7dcfa0af16ba896159b4
spent
true